Meet Dr. Janiga-

 

                                           


Mark A. Janiga, M.D., Diplomate of the American Board of Pain Medicine, Diplomate of the American Board of Anesthesiology, is a graduate of the Nevada School of Medicine in Reno, Nevada.

 

Dr. Janiga completed his Anesthesiology residency at the University of Wisconsin in Madison, Wisconsin, and completed his Interventional Pain Management fellowship at the University of Michigan.

 

He is committed to providing patients the latest in diagnostic and therapeutic pain-relieving treatments. Prolotherapy is one of Dr. Janiga's most relied upon and favorite pain-relieving therapies for soft tissue/ligamentous/tendon problems.

 

Sacro-iliac (SI) joint, low back, upper cervical (neck) pain, and sports related musculoskeletal pain are his special areas of interest.
